Key Ingredients for a Standout Sweet & Spicy Pineapple Curry

Crafting a truly exceptional pineapple curry begins with selecting the right ingredients. Each component plays a crucial role in building the complex layers of flavor.

The Foundation: Aromatics and Protein

* Chicken: We opt for boneless, skinless chicken breasts for a lean and tender result, mirroring how it's often served in restaurants. However, chicken thighs are an excellent alternative, offering more succulence and being more forgiving if slightly overcooked. For those seeking vegetarian options, firm tofu or tempeh are fantastic choices that absorb the curry's flavors beautifully. * Onion & Garlic: These humble aromatics are the unsung heroes of many great dishes, and our pineapple curry is no exception. Sautéing them creates a fragrant base, adding depth and a subtle sweetness that complements the other strong flavors. While some curries benefit from ginger, for this particular recipe, we're focusing on the pure essence of the curry paste and lime leaves, keeping it true to its inspiration.

The Heart of the Flavor: Mae Ploy Curry Paste

This is where the magic truly happens. Of all the curry pastes I’ve tried, **Mae Ploy** consistently delivers. It has an unparalleled authenticity that instantly elevates homemade curry to restaurant-level quality. * Red Curry Paste: Mae Ploy's red curry paste provides a vibrant base with a balanced level of spice and a rich aromatic profile. It’s perfect for achieving that classic Thai red curry flavor. * Panang Curry Paste: If you prefer a slightly thicker, richer, and often a touch spicier curry with hints of peanuts (though Mae Ploy Panang is generally nut-free), their Panang paste is a fantastic choice that also works beautifully here. Pro Tip on Spice: Mae Ploy tends to be on the milder side compared to some other brands, which is great for building flavor without overwhelming heat. Start with 2 tablespoons for a mild curry, and feel free to go up to 4 tablespoons or more if you crave a spicier kick. If you're using a different brand, taste as you go, as their spice levels can vary dramatically!

The Stars: Pineapple and Key Aromatics

* Pineapple: The star of the show! Fresh pineapple is always preferred for its vibrant flavor and texture. Frozen pineapple works wonderfully too – just ensure it’s thawed slightly. Canned pineapple is an option, but make sure it’s unsweetened and drain the juice, reserving it to add a splash at the end if you desire more sweetness. Its natural acidity and sweetness are what define this pineapple curry. * Kaffir Lime Leaves: These fragrant leaves are non-negotiable for authentic Thai flavor. They infuse the curry with a unique citrusy, floral aroma that is simply irreplaceable. Look for them in the refrigerated section of Asian grocery stores. A little goes a long way! * Bell Pepper: Adds a beautiful pop of color and a mild, sweet crunch. Red bell pepper is particularly visually appealing, but any color will do. Feel free to incorporate other vegetables you enjoy, such as bamboo shoots, green beans, or snap peas.

The Finishers: Balance and Brightness

* Coconut Sugar: A touch of sweetness is traditional in Thai curries and helps to balance the heat and acidity. Coconut sugar offers a subtle caramel note. Add it to taste – you might find you don't need much, especially if using naturally sweet fresh pineapple. * Fish Sauce: Essential for authentic umami depth. Don't skip it! A good quality fish sauce will enhance all the other flavors without making the curry taste "fishy." * Cilantro/Thai Basil: Freshly chopped cilantro stirred in at the end provides a bright, herbaceous finish. Thai basil is another fantastic option, offering a slightly anise-like flavor that pairs incredibly well with Thai curries.

Mastering the Perfect Pineapple Curry: Step-by-Step

Creating this vibrant pineapple curry is surprisingly straightforward. Here’s how to bring it all together for maximum flavor.

Step 1: Building the Aromatic Base

Begin by sautéing your chopped onion and minced garlic in a little oil in a large pot or wok over medium heat. Cook until the onion is translucent and softened, about 3-4 minutes. This step is crucial for releasing their fragrant oils and building a foundational layer of flavor.

Step 2: Blooming the Curry Paste

Once the aromatics are soft, add your chosen Mae Ploy curry paste. Break it up with your spoon and sauté it for 1-2 minutes, stirring constantly. This process, known as "blooming" the paste, gently fries the spices, allowing their full aromatic potential to develop and preventing a raw, pasty taste. Remember, 2 tablespoons for mild, more for adventurous palates!

Step 3: Simmering the Sauce

Gradually stir in your coconut milk, ensuring the curry paste is fully incorporated. Add the kaffir lime leaves (bruise them slightly before adding to release more aroma), fish sauce, and a pinch of coconut sugar if using.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er, then reduce the heat to low. Let it simmer, covered, for 6-8 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ully and the bell pepper (if adding at this stage) to become tender-crisp.

Step 4: Adding Protein and Pineapple

Increase the heat slightly and add your cubed chicken. Stir to combine, ensuring the chicken is coated in the flavorful sauce. Next, fold in your pineapple chunks. Continue to cook, stirring occasionally, just until the chicken is cooked through and no longer pink. Overcooking the chicken can make it dry, and overcooking the pineapple can make it mushy, so keep a close eye on it, typically 5-7 minutes.

Step 5: Final Adjustments and Garnish

Taste your pineapple curry. This is your chance to adjust. Does it need more salt (from fish sauce)? A touch more sweetness (from coconut sugar or reserved pineapple juice)? A squeeze of fresh lime juice can also brighten the flavors. Finally, remove the kaffir lime leaves (or leave them for presentation, just remind diners not to eat them) and stir in a generous handful of freshly chopped cilantro or Thai basil. Customization & Serving Suggestions

One of the joys of cooking is making a dish your own. This pineapple curry is incredibly adaptable: * Spice Level: As mentioned, adjust the amount of curry paste. For an extra kick, add a few fresh bird's eye chilies or a pinch of red pepper flakes during the blooming step. * Vegetarian/Vegan: Substitute chicken with firm tofu, tempeh, chickpeas, or a medley of your favorite vegetables like sweet potatoes, cauliflower, or green beans. Ensure your curry paste is vegan-friendly (some contain shrimp paste, though Mae Ploy typically does). Use a vegan fish sauce substitute. * Different Proteins: Shrimp, pork, or even duck would be delicious alternatives to chicken. If using shrimp, add it only in the last 2-3 minutes of cooking to prevent overcooking. * Serving Suggestions: This vibrant curry is traditionally served with fragrant jasmine rice, which perfectly absorbs the creamy, flavorful sauce. It's also delicious with brown rice, quinoa, or even rice noodles for a lighter meal. A sprinkle of crushed peanuts, extra fresh herbs, or a wedge of lime for squeezing adds a delightful finishing touch.
